本帖最后由 FFF 于 2013-11-14 21:01 编辑
$(function () {
//密码校验
$("#password").blur(function(){
var password = $(this).val().trim();
if(password === null || password === ""){
$("#passwordMsg").text("密码不能为空");
$("#passwordMsg").addClass("error_msg");
nameFlag = false;
return;
}
var ZE = /^[0-9a-zA-Z_]{0,30}$/;
var bool = ZE.test(password);
if(!bool){
$("#passwordMsg").text("30长度以内的字母、数字和下划线的组合");
$("#passwordMsg").addClass("error_msg");
nameFlag = false;
return;
}else{
$("#passwordMsg").text("30长度以内的字母、数字和下划线的组合");
$("#passwordMsg").removeClass("error_msg");
nameFlag = true;
return;
}
});
//重复密码校验
$("#passwords").blur(function(){
var password = $("#password").val();
var passwords = $(this).val();
alert(password);
alert(passwords);
if(passwords == null || passwords == ""){
$("#passwordsMsg").text("重复密码不能为空");
$("#passwordsMsg").addClass("error_msg");
nameFlag = false;
return;
}
if(password != passwords){
$("#passwordsMsg").text("密码重复错误");
$("#passwordsMsg").addClass("error_msg");
nameFlag = false;
return;
}else{
$("#passwordsMsg").text("两次密码必须相同");
$("#passwordsMsg").removeClass("error_msg");
nameFlag = true;
return;
}
});
});
密码校验 失败
重复密码校验 获取 上一个密码值 为null
帮帮忙啊
|